1964 Lotus Seven vs. 1996 Suzuki Samurai
To start off, 1996 Suzuki Samurai is newer by 32 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1964 Lotus Seven.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1964 Lotus Seven would be higher. At 1,296 cc (4 cylinders), 1996 Suzuki Samurai is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1996 Suzuki Samurai (69 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 31 more horse power than 1964 Lotus Seven. (38 HP @ 5000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1996 Suzuki Samurai should accelerate faster than 1964 Lotus Seven.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1996 Suzuki Samurai weights approximately 498 kg more than 1964 Lotus Seven.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Because 1996 Suzuki Samurai is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1964 Lotus Seven.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1996 Suzuki Samurai will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
Compare all specifications:
1964 Lotus Seven | 1996 Suzuki Samurai | |
Make | Lotus | Suzuki |
Model | Seven | Samurai |
Year Released | 1964 | 1996 |
Body Type | Roadster | SUV |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 997 cc | 1296 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 38 HP | 69 HP |
Engine RPM | 5000 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| 4WD |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 432 kg | 930 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3360 mm | 3450 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1490 mm | 1540 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1100 mm | 1670 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2240 mm | 2490 mm |
